Sri Lanka bat after winning the toss

Sri Lankan captain Mahela Jayawardene won the toss and opted to bat in the final day-night international match against Pakistan at Gaddafi Stadium here today.


The visitors made no change from the team which won by 129 runs in Karachi on Wednesday.



Pakistan made two changes, dropping out-of-form Shoaib Akhtar and Sohail Tanvir and bringing in paceman Sohail Khan and off-spinner Saeed Ajmal.


Pakistan won the first match, also played in Karachi, on Tuesday.


Teams: Pakistan: Shoaib Malik (capt), Khurram Manzoor, Salman Butt, Younus Khan, Misbah-ul-Haq, Shahid Afridi, Kamran Akmal, Sohail Khan, Umar Gul, Rao Iftikhar, Saeed Ajmal


Sri Lanka: Mahela Jayawardene (capt), Kumar Sangakkara, Sanath Jayasuriya, Chamara Kapugedera, Thilina Kandamby, Tillakaratne Dilshan, Muttiah Muralitharan, Nuwan Kulasekara, Thilan Thushara, Ajantha Mendis, Farveez Maharoof
